24 September 2012 As an Accountant I have just joined a Pvt. Ltd. Co. - Logistic Co.
Our co. have not filed Income Tax return since FY 2006-07 till date. Due to some reasons even Accounts are not Finalized.
What should i do?
Since last 2 years Turn over per year is about 2cr.
Directly Can we file this years FY 2011-12 IT Return?
Pls reply urgently.

24 September 2012 Dear Friend, according the provisions of Income Tax Act, 1961 as well as companies act, 1956 a private/public limited company is required to file its audited accounts annually. In case of non filing of accounts or return a penalty of 0.5% of Turnover or Rs. 150000/- whichever is less levied for each year. You can file return for only two preceding previous years not for five years. Thanks
